Marching through Time

Marietta Mansion is hosting their annual Marching through Time reenactment with reenactors representing Celts--through Viet Nam.

250+ reenactors in individual encampments are ready to take your questions and will be putting on drill & firing demonstrations from mid Morning Saturday throughout the afternoon.

naturally Civil War and WWII have a large group but there are plenty from the Medieval period and colonial.

Cost is around 8.00 per adult and 5 per child. There will be a number of tents for merchants to browse too.

I will be commanding my colonial militia and am hoping there is a strong turn out for Saturday because Sunday looks horrendous weather-wise. Please Come out an encourage these volunteers.

Event is perfect for homeschool families, military historians, and anyone who is bored with the Renn Faire schtick.
